Symbolic Meanings

If you are thinking that orchid designed tattoos are just mere decorations on someone’s body, then you are definitely wrong. There are a lot more interesting things about these tattoos, apart from being gorgeous body adornments. In other words, these symbolize a lot of things, and here are some of them:

  • Elegance – In case you want to look elegant in front of many people even to those tattoo haters, then the best tattoo design that you should have is the orchid. This flower certainly look elegant when you see it in person, which is why it represents elegance.
  • Beauty – Just like any other flower designed tattoos, it is also representing beauty. The explanation of this is just a literal one. It is because the flower is extremely beautiful that you might fall in love with it the moment you see it with your two naked eyes.
  • Rareness – Just in case you don’t know, an orchid flower is very rare. As a matter of fact, its extreme rareness is one reason why this flower is being loved by a lot of people from all over the globe.
  • Fertility – It is also believed that an orchid flower symbolizes fertility. One good reason for this is the fact that this flower resembles much to the reproductive anatomy of male and female human beings.
  • Mystery – The orchid flower is also known to represent mystery. It is simply because you might find it growing in a place where you don’t expect it to grow. In fact, there are several wild orchids that you can find in a forest. If you want to appear as a mysterious type of a person, then an orchid designed tattoo is great for you.

Some other things that orchid art represent are eroticism, sensuality, strength, power, grace, innocence, purity, and royalty.

History of Orchids

Just like the other gorgeous flowers that are used as great subjects for tattooing, the first existence of the orchid flower as well as the orchid art can be traced back a number of years in the past. This flower has been linked to a lot of cultures in the world, particularly to those Asian people. According to Asian people, an orchid flower represents fertility. For you to know, the word orchid actually means “testicle” that is related to the reproductive organs of male and female human beings. For the ancient Greeks, they called an orchid flower as the “Flower of Magnificence”. It was simply because they were highly captivated by the extreme grace and splendor of this particular flower.

For Aztecs people, they believed that the orchid had something to do with power and strength. Furthermore, nations like China, Germany, and Egypt used this flower as an aphrodisiac. It was very useful in preparing ancient medicinal systems of the mentioned countries just like making love potions. Some other cultures in the world used the orchid in determining the sex organ of an about to be born baby. In these cultures, the mother should eat orchid flowers if she wanted to have a female baby. On the other hand, the father would be the one to eat the flower if he wanted to have a male baby. Since the orchid flower played a major role in their lives, many of them decided to acknowledge it through orchid tattoos.

Significance

Orchids are flowers of great elegance and beauty, plus the fact that they are rare makes them highly desirable among tattoo enthusiasts and designers too. These flowers have been revered in various cultures around the world, particularly in the Asian culture, where they are associated with fertility. Here, the flowers are used to depict male and female sexual organs. The name of the flower is in fact derived from the word Orchids, which literally means testicles.

A group of orchid flowers is seen as a representation of female organs while the expression “purple orchid” is used to define a male reproductive organ. This makes orchid tattoos related with sensuality and eroticism.
The Greeks knew this flower by the name of Flower of Magnificence because of its splendid beauty and grace, while the Aztecs associated orchids with power and strength. It was even used as an aphrodisiac to prepare love potions in the ancient medicinal systems of countries like Egypt, Germany and China.

In certain cultures, the flower was even used to determine the sex of an unborn child. If the couple wanted a male child, the father would eat orchids and for a female child, the mother would have to consume the flower. Some other symbolic meanings associated with this amazing flower are royalty purity, luxury, elegance, innocence, mystery, fertility and delicacy. While the association with beauty and elegance makes the orchid flower tattoo design a popular option for women, men show an inclination towards this tattoo because of its symbolic relation with potency and sensuality. Therefore, orchid flower art have both male and female connotations, which make them a good choice for both the genders.

Popular Orchid Flower Tattoo Designs

Orchids make an amazing choice for tattoo lovers because of sheer variety available in the designs containing this exotic flower as the basic element. In fact, there are 25000 species of orchids found across the globe, with vanillas orchids, cymbidium and dendrobium being the most common and well known ones. The flowers grow in an array of vibrant colors such as red, orange, yellow, pink, blue and many more. As a result, the tattoo artist has a great number of options to create some unique designs by making use of the different colors, sizes and shapes in which various species of orchids grow in nature. The use of right hues and design can create a stunning visual impact and it also give s a symbolic value to the tattoo design, which are the main reasons why people have tattoos inked on their body. Orchid is the flower of the wild, which is why most of the tattoos are designed to feature them that way.

Certain other elements like birds, butterflies, leaves and grass can be combined with orchid as the main element, to create an eye catching tattoo design. The tattoo can be inked in any size depending upon the location which is chosen by the tattoo bearer to be inked.

Since these tattoos are very elegant, most of them would like the tattoo to be prominent and have them placed at highly visible locations such as the shoulder, forearm, wrist, ankle, calf and lower back.
